In the continuous distillation of methanol twin towers, if the methanol content at the top of the pre-tower is high, in terms of the feed position, should it be moved up or down?
In the pre-column, the light components should be non-condensable gases, ethers and other low-boiling substances, and methanol and water should be heavy components. Since there are more heavy components at the top of the tower, the height of the distillation section should be increased and the feed port should be lowered.
